How Big Is a 30 Yard Dumpster?

The 30 yard dumpster size runs about 22 feet long, 8 feet wide and 6 feet tall, and those 30 yard dumpster dimensions and measurements shift a little by manufacturer. That box swallows framing lumber, drywall, shingles and bulky furniture without much sorting. Whether you call it a 30 yard roll off dumpster or a 30 yard roll-off dumpster rental, New Haven Porta Pros delivers these units on a roll-off truck that needs about 60 feet of straight clearance behind it, so check your driveway or curb space before booking. If your lot is tight or the alley is narrow, a smaller box makes more sense. What Can't Go in a 30 Yard Dumpster?

Most household and construction debris is fine, but paints, solvents, tires, batteries and certain electronics usually aren't. Weight matters too. Roofing shingles and concrete get heavy fast, and going over your contracted tonnage adds cost. How much clearance does the delivery truck need?

Roll-off trucks need about 60 feet of straight clearance behind the drop point. Narrow driveways, low branches or tight alleys can rule out delivery, so measure before scheduling with New Haven Porta Pros.
